Sterilization technology market is experiencing significant growth in all regions, owing to the increasing standards of health care, the growing awareness of infection control, and the advancement in sterilization technology. Each region has its own characteristics, which are influenced by local regulations, health care systems, and cultural attitudes to hygiene and safety. The demand for sterilization technology is particularly strong in the health care industry, where infection prevention measures are of paramount importance. Moreover, the application of sterilization technology is increasingly being adopted in the food and pharmaceutical industries.

Europe

  • The European Union has implemented stricter regulations regarding medical device sterilization, leading to increased demand for advanced sterilization technologies that comply with these new standards.
  • Companies such as Getinge AB and Ecolab are focusing on developing automated sterilization systems that enhance efficiency and reduce human error, reflecting a trend towards automation in healthcare settings.

Asia Pacific

  • Rapid urbanization and increasing healthcare expenditure in countries like China and India are driving the demand for sterilization technologies, particularly in hospitals and clinics.
  • Innovations in sterilization methods, such as the use of hydrogen peroxide vapor and ozone sterilization, are being adopted by local companies like TSO3 Inc. to meet the growing needs of the healthcare sector.

Latin America

  • The Latin American market is seeing a rise in regulatory frameworks aimed at improving healthcare standards, which is driving the adoption of sterilization technologies in hospitals.
  • Local companies are increasingly collaborating with international firms to enhance their sterilization capabilities, reflecting a trend towards globalization in the market.

North America

  • The U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) has recently updated its guidelines on sterilization processes, emphasizing the need for validation and monitoring, which is pushing manufacturers to adopt more advanced sterilization technologies.
  • Key players like Steris Corporation and 3M are investing heavily in R&D to innovate sterilization solutions, particularly in the areas of low-temperature sterilization and environmentally friendly methods, which are gaining traction in hospitals.

Middle East And Africa

  • The Middle East is witnessing a surge in healthcare investments, with governments prioritizing infection control measures, which is boosting the sterilization technology market.
  • Organizations like the World Health Organization (WHO) are actively promoting sterilization practices in the region, leading to increased awareness and adoption of advanced sterilization technologies.

โ€œDid you know that steam sterilization, one of the oldest methods, remains the most widely used sterilization technique in healthcare settings, accounting for over 80% of sterilization processes?โ€ โ€” World Health Organization (WHO)

The Sterilization Technology Market is a growth market, mainly driven by the increasing demand for infection control in hospitals. The key driving factors for this market are the stringent regulatory policies that are aimed at ensuring patient safety and the rising prevalence of hospital-acquired infections. In addition, the development of new sterilization methods such as ethylene-oxide and hydrogen-peroxide-plasma sterilization, which are more efficient and effective, is also expected to drive the market. Moreover, the current market is characterized by the presence of well-established players, such as STERIS and 3M, which have established themselves as leaders in this field. The key end-uses of these sterilization methods are surgical instrument sterilization, pharmaceutical manufacturing, and laboratory equipment decontamination. The increasing focus on sterilization methods, especially in the wake of the H1N1 pandemic, has prompted governments to tighten regulations in this regard. In addition, the growing focus on sustainable development has also influenced the market, as companies are increasingly investing in the development of eco-friendly sterilization methods. In addition, the development of new sterilization methods, such as automated sterilization systems and real-time monitoring tools, is expected to play a key role in shaping the future of the market.
